Telechargé par lalofa2002

L3 S2 BE622 Corrige

publicité
Corrigé : Matière BE622
Partie 1: Questions de cours
1. Définir un système embarqué (2 pts)
Système électronique et informatique autonome dédié à une tâche précise, souvent en temps réel, possédant
une taille limitée et ayant une consommation énergétique restreinte.
Un système embarqué est un système électronique et informatique, qui est dédié ou spécialisé dans une tâche
bien précise.
2. Caractéristiques : (2 pts)
▪ Coût réduit, maximisation rapport performance/prix
▪ Volume restreint (compact, pas modulaire)
▪ Capacité mémoire adaptée
▪ Capacité de calcul appropriée à l'application
▪ Exécution temps réel (souvent)
▪ Fiabilité et sécurité de fonctionnement
▪ Consommation d’énergie maitrisée (très faible en cas d’utilisation sur batterie)
3. Architecture générale des systèmes embarqués : (4 pts)
1. Différence entre un microprocesseur et un microcontrôleur : (2 pts)
Un microcontrôleur est un système, constitué de l’ensemble microprocesseur avec RAM, ROM,
EEPROM, convertisseurs CAN/CNA et interfaces d’entrées/sorties, intégrés dans une même
structure (un même circuit).
Base de
comparaison
Microprocesseur
Microcontrôleur
De base
Composé d'une seule puce
comprenant une ALU, un CU et
des registres.
Composé d'un microprocesseur, d'une
mémoire, d'un port d'E / S, d'une unité de
contrôle d'interruption, etc.
Caractéristiques
Unité dépendante
Unité autonome
Ports d'E/S
Ne contient pas de port d'E/S
intégré
Les ports d'E/S intégrés sont présents
Type d'opération
effectuée
Usage général dans la conception Orienté application ou spécifique au
et l'exploitation.
domaine.
Ciblé pour
Marché haut de gamme
Marché embarqué
Consommation
d'énergie
Fournit moins d'options
d'économie d'énergie
Inclut plus d'options d'économie d'énergie
4. Les démarche à suivre pour concevoir et réaliser un système embarqué sont : (2 pts)
Partant d’un cahier de charge dans lequel est défini la structure globale du SE, il faut :
1- Déterminer les composants matériels.
2- Déterminer le système d’exploitation (pour système embarqué) le plus approprié à la réalisation du SE, s’il
y a lieu d’utiliser un système d’exploitation.
3- Choisir une plateforme de développement : plate-forme sur laquelle vont être mis au point les différentes
parties logicielles.
4 - Choisir une méthode de développement ou d’accès entre la plateforme de développement et la cible.
5. Partie 2 :QCM ( 1 pts pour chaque question)
1. Un microprocesseur contient :
☒
☐
☒
☒
L’unité arithmétique et logique
Mémoire
Les registres
L’unité de contrôle
2. Un microcontrôleur est un microprocesseur dans lequel on a ajouté au sein du même boîtier un:
☒
☒
☒
☒
Convertisseurs analogiques /numérique numérique/analogique
Timer
Mémoire
Entrée-sorties
3. L’architecture VON NEUMANN utilise :
☒
☐
☐
1 Bus de données
2 Bus de données
3 bus de données
4. Un système embarqué est un appareillage remplissant une mission spécifique en utilisant :
☒
☒
☒
☒
Microprocesseurs
Calculateurs
Actionneurs
Périphériques d’entrée sortie
5. Un système embarqué est une construction
☐
☒
Modulaire
Non modulaire
6. Un système embarqué permet de :
☐
☒
☐
Programmer un système
Contrôler et piloter un système
Simuler l’environnement d’un système
7. Un système embarqué est dit temps réel s’il respecte :
☒
☒
☒
Le temps de réponse
L’urgence
La durée du traitement
8. Un système embarqué :
☐
☒
Evolue dans un environnement contrôlé
N’évolue pas dans un environnement contrôlé
Téléchargement